Country:
Region:
City:
Similar words:
passport office in Roodepoort, Western Cape
About 231 results.
One Visa World
5 Helene Road, 7579 Cape Town, South AfricaVisa Logistics expedites Police Clearance Certificates.We offer attestation of documents.We process Saudi Arabia, Dubai, Turkey & China Visas.